The new UTS-800 training aircraft manufactured by the Ural Civil Aviation Plant (UZGA) will help the Air Force (Air Force) accelerate the transition of combat pilots to MiG-29 fighters in service. The aircraft will be presented at the International Exhibition of Defense and Military Industry EDEX-2025 in Cairo from December 1 to 4.
UZGA expects that the UTS-800 will be of interest to the Egyptian Air Force as a modern, economical and effective tool for training pilots.
Its key advantages are the potential reduction in training costs and ideal compatibility with Russian aviation equipment, which makes it a logical choice for modernizing the training fleet.
The press service of the plant recalled that the UTS-800 is unified in components and ergonomics with Russian combat aircraft.
This can facilitate and speed up the transition of Egyptian cadets to machines such as the MiG-29, which are in service with the Egyptian Air Force.
UZGA noted that the UTS-800 is designed for initial flight training, professional selection and professional training of pilots.
